City Cycling Tour

A bike tour around the streets of Belfast, passing interesting landmarks

This cycling tour will get you up close to the sights of Belfast, taking you through the heart of the city and into key neighbourhoods. You’ll set off from the city centre, viewing the street art and murals related to the political period dubbed The Troubles. You’ll stop to write a message on the Peace Wall before visiting one of the oldest pubs in Ireland.

Your guide will lead you past a wide range of landmarks like Belfast City Hall, the botanical gardens, Ulster Museum and Palm House, through the Holy Lands and along the River Lagan. You’ll stop at St George’s Market to sample some traditional foods before exploring the Titanic Quarter and trendy Cathedral Quarter.
